Background of the Invention Actuators use liquid, gas, electricity or other energy sources and convert them into drive action through motors, cylinders or other devices. The basic actuator is used to drive the valve to the fully open or fully closed position. Actuating and control valve actuators enable precise positioning of the valve to any position. Although most actuators are used for on-off valves, today's actuators are designed to go beyond the simple switching functions of position sensing, torque sensing, electrode protection, logic control, digital communication modules And PID control module, etc., and these devices are all installed in a compact housing. In the prior art, there is no disc spring on the upper connecting piece and the lower connecting piece, so that when the closing force of the closing valve is shut off due to the hard closing of the valve, the sealing surface is damaged and killed. The fixing hole is internally provided with an internal thread. The upper connecting piece is composed of an upper connecting piece through hole and an upper connecting piece sleeve. The edge of the through hole of the upper connector is provided with a chamfer. The outer diameter of the upper connector is smaller than the inner diameter of the lower connector by 4 mm. The rigidity of the disc spring is large, the buffering vibration absorbing ability is strong, and can bear large loads with small deformation. The utility model is a novel valve actuator connecting device, the structure is installed between the upper connector and the lower connector disc spring, so that the actuator closing force when the valve is closed to increase the flexibility will not be hard to connect Close too fast and cause sealing surface damage, seizures and so on.
